문제
다음 반정규화 기법 적용 사례 중 성능 저하를 야기할 가능성이 가장 높은 것은?
① 주문 테이블에 고객명 컬럼을 중복 저장하여 조인 연산을 제거 ② 월별 집계 테이블을 별도로 생성하여 복잡한 GROUP BY 연산을 회피 ③ 대용량 로그 테이블을 읽기 전용과 쓰기 전용으로 수직 분할 ④ 자주 변경되는 재고 수량을 모든 관련 테이블에 중복 저장
정답
4번
해설
④번은 자주 변경되는 데이터를 여러 테이블에 중복 저장하므로 데이터 동기화 오버헤드가 크고 일관성 문제가 발생할 가능성이 높아 성능 저하를 야기합니다. ①②③번은 모두 적절한 반정규화 기법으로 성능 향상에 기여합니다.